Deciding Between Senior Apartment vs. Independent Living

Seniors are living longer, fuller lives, yet will still need extra care as they age and reach that inevitable time. The type of care you need today may look very different than what you need in five, ten, or 20 years. Many retire in their sixties and live well into their eighties or nineties. When deciding on a home for your retirement, you will need to consider several factors to decide which is better;  independent living vs. senior apartments. Some of these factors can include:

  • How much you can afford
  • Your current level of activity
  • The type of amenities you want
  • If their homes and facilities are HUD compliant for senior living
  • Available access to medical or cognitive care as your needs change
  • Proximity to family and friends

What Are the Differences Between Independent Living vs. Senior Apartments?

When deciding on your new home to enjoy your golden years, base your decision on the quality of life you want to live. Some of the key differences between senior apartments vs. independent living include:

  • Senior apartments are more affordable than independent living. They don’t offer the same level of planned activities or home and personal services, and some senior apartments may be covered by state funding programs for seniors with minimal savings.
  • Independent living offers comprehensive services, including meal plans, housekeeping services, laundry services, and much more. Some communities also include on-site urgent care and wellness centers to take care of any medical emergency or rehab care.
  • Senior apartments are best for seniors who are just starting their retirement and don’t need all of the amenities and services of independent living. When their medical needs change, and they need more care, they will need to move into a community that offers assisted living.
  • Independent living gives seniors access to more medical care, such as memory care, short and long-term rehabilitation, and skilled nursing care, without the need to move to a new community.

Deciding between independent living vs. senior apartments is a very personal choice. You want to find a community that gives you the lifestyle and services you want that you can afford for however long your retirement will be.
